The Digital Keepsake: Documenting Your Love StoryEvery relationship has a unique origin story filled with serendipitous moments, inside jokes, and shared milestones. One of the most fulfilling podcast ideas for couples is to treat the microphone as a digital time capsule. Instead of broadcasting to a massive global audience, the primary goal of this show is preservation. Couples can record thematic episodes detailing how they met, their first major trip together, or the challenges they overcame during their first year of cohabitation. Over time, these audio files become a living history, allowing the couple and their future generations to hear the exact inflection of their voices and the raw emotion behind their memories. To make it engaging for external listeners, couples can invite guest couples to share their own origin stories, comparing the different paths people take to find love.

The Shared Hobby ChronicleWhen two people share a deep passion for a specific niche, it naturally breeds fascinating conversation. A hobby-centric podcast leverages this shared enthusiasm, whether the topic is deep-space astronomy, competitive board gaming, vegan cooking, or architectural history. By focusing the podcast on an activity rather than the relationship itself, couples can project a highly professional yet intrinsically connected dynamic. Listeners are drawn to the natural chemistry and effortless banter that comes from years of mutual understanding, which adds a layer of warmth that solo hosts or casual co-hosts rarely replicate. Each episode can feature a deep dive into a specific aspect of the hobby, product reviews, or interviews with experts, all filtered through the unique lens of a dual-perspective partnership.

The Blind Taste Test and Review ShowFood and culture are universal unifiers, making them excellent fodder for a collaborative audio project. A highly entertaining concept involves couples introducing each other to new experiences blindly on air. One partner selects a mysterious snack, a obscure movie, a bizarre piece of literature, or a specific genre of music, while the other experiences it for the very first time during the recording. The authentic, unedited reactions provide immediate comedic value and genuine human moments. This format keeps the content fresh and structurally dynamic, as the roles of curator and reviewer alternate with each episode. It also encourages couples to step outside their comfort zones, fostering shared growth while providing highly structured, easily digestible content for an audience that loves reviews and reaction media.

The Great Debate: Low-Stakes ArgumentsConflict is a natural part of any relationship, but when channeled into trivial, low-stakes topics, it becomes comedic gold. A debate-style podcast allows couples to argue passionately over completely unimportant matters. Topics can range from whether pineapple belongs on pizza and the optimal way to load a dishwasher, to analyzing which cinematic universe has the best lore. By establishing a lighthearted courtroom format where each partner presents evidence, calls hypothetical witnesses, and pleads their case, the show taps into relatable domestic humor. Listeners can vote on social media to determine the winner of each week’s debate. This format highlights the couple’s ability to disagree playfully, showcasing healthy communication wrapped in entertainment.

The Co-Authors: Creating Fiction TogetherFor the creatively inclined, building a fictional world together offers a profound collaborative outlet. A storytelling or world-building podcast involves the couple co-writing a narrative in real-time. They can take turns writing alternating chapters of a fantasy novel, role-playing characters in a customized tabletop game, or spinning spooky campfire tales. This format relies heavily on improvisation and the creative trust between partners. Listeners get to experience the raw creative process unfolding, witnessing how one partner’s plot twist challenges the other to adapt. The resulting narrative is often completely unpredictable, rich with collaborative energy, and highly addictive for fans of audio dramas and creative writing.
